About the Ford Kuga st-line x phev cvt
The Ford Kuga st-line x phev cvt has been tested 3,205 times in 2026 MOT data across 3 model years (2020 to 2022), with an average pass rate of 96%. That's comfortably above the national average of 82%, making it a reliable choice. Available as hybrid.
Best and Worst Years
The 2022 model is the most reliable with a 100% pass rate from 30 tests. The 2020 model has the lowest at 93%. The 7 point spread between years means reliability varies somewhat, but no year is dramatically different.
Mileage Across Years
The oldest model in our data (2020) averages 33,015 miles, while the newest (2022) averages 31,827 miles.
Compared to the Ford brand average of 85%, the Kuga st-line x phev cvt performs 11 points better, making it one of the more reliable options in the Ford range.
